Finally all finished rebuilt the 13B-T and the gearbix new syncro's and and new bearings and a new shaft one was a little worn.

Got RED back last Tuesday it arrived at work in the tow truck and I put Blue (1KZ) on the tow truck to get new BRAKES and new trailing arm bushes. The newly rebuilt 13B-T ready I was told to drive it carefully and test it out do not go over 2100rpm and check the noise.

Red was not happy it started tapping noise at 2000rpm. THis morning (Saturday) took out to the workshop and we fixed the Blue 1KZ nightmare up after the Quiet Sungai Mas trail trip last weekend.
1. New trailing arm bushes
2. New leading arm bushes and castor correction also
3. Straightned steering arm
4. Drained DIFFS (yes they had water in them) and refilled
5. CHanged SUMP (took me 2+ hours to change) as the 1KZ engine in BLUE was from a HIACE and the front PROP shaft had given it more than a FEW WHACKS almost through the sump the damage was quite bad. BE warned anyone who puts in a HIACE 1KZ change the sump or remove the front PROP shaft LOL.
6. Refilled and ready to rock again.
7. After lunch started stripping REDs 13B-T down slowly stripped around the head and finally lifted it. BINGO we could see the noise reason. YEs the valves had touched the pistons on pistons 1 and 4 mainly. WE measured the head gasket and the old one was 1.65mm and the new one was 1.35mm. Monday we will know what we can buy here to provide a solution.
